Finnish Prime Minister Sanna Marin said on Monday that the country is working to lift all COVID-19-related restrictions in February.
Marin's announcement came at a meeting with the Finnish Association of Editors, just two days after Finland entered its third pandemic year.
"The restrictions should be lifted during February, as the tolerance of the citizens has been tested for a long time," she told Finnish daily Ilta-Samomat.
Marin said that her government will negotiate its strategy for easing pandemic measures on Wednesday.
However, Finnish health experts expressed concern.
